Causes of Car Accidents in Spring Hill

Car crashes in Spring Hill happen for many different reasons, just like in other parts of Florida. However, local traffic patterns, road conditions, and driver behavior can all contribute to higher risks in specific areas. Understanding what caused the crash is the first step in determining legal liability.

Some of the most common causes of car accidents in Spring Hill include:

  • Distracted Driving: Drivers are distracted by texting, using navigation apps, adjusting the radio, or eating while driving, all of which take a driver’s attention off the road. Even a slight moment of distraction can lead to rear-end collisions or missed traffic signals.
  • Speeding and Aggressive Driving: Drivers who exceed speed limits—especially on major roads like Mariner Boulevard or Spring Hill Drive—reduce their reaction time and increase the scope of impact in the event of a crash.
  • Failure to Yield: Intersections throughout Spring Hill, particularly those with high traffic volume or limited visibility, are frequent sites of T-bone accidents caused by failure to yield or running red lights.
  • Drunk Impaired Driving: Alcohol and drug impairment continue to be a major factor in serious and fatal crashes. Impaired drivers have diminished coordination and delayed judgment and are more likely to drive recklessly.
  • Following Too Closely: Tailgating is a leading cause of rear-end collisions, especially during heavy traffic or sudden stops. In many cases, these accidents result in whiplash or spinal injuries.
  • Inexperienced or Elderly Drivers: Florida’s diverse driving population includes a high number of teen and elderly drivers. While not inherently unsafe, inexperience or diminished reaction times can contribute to misjudgments and increased crash risk.

Over the decades of experience with personal injury claims, we have noted that it’s not possible to have two car accident cases that are the same. This means the potential compensation will vary from case to case, depending on various factors. Some of the factors that can influence the amount of combination in your case include:

Liability Disputes

In any personal injury case, establishing who was at fault is essential. Settlement negotiations are usually more straightforward if the other party’s liability is clear, such as in a rear-end collision with video evidence. However, the insurance company may reduce or deny your payout if the other driver disputes fault or claims you contributed to the crash.

Florida's modified comparative fault law dictates that if you are more than 50% responsible for the accident, you cannot recover any damages. If you are 50% or less at fault, your recovery decreases by your percentage of fault. When either party contests liability, you need a thorough investigation to improve the outcome.

The Severity of Your Injuries

Insurance companies assign more value to claims involving serious or permanent injuries. High-impact crashes that lead to traumatic brain injuries, spinal cord damage, or long-term disability are not only more expensive to treat, but they often affect every aspect of the victim’s life.

Courts and insurers also consider the duration of medical treatment, the extent of recovery, and the likelihood of future complications when assessing damages. Minor injuries may still be compensable, but long-term or life-altering conditions generally warrant higher settlements or verdicts.

Availability of Insurance Coverage

The amount of compensation you can recover is also limited by the insurance coverage available. If the at-fault driver has only the minimum coverage required by law, and you do not have uninsured or underinsured motorist protection, your recovery may be restricted regardless of the severity of your injuries.

In contrast, if multiple insurance policies apply, such as in commercial vehicle accidents or multi-party claims, your lawyer can pursue compensation from several sources. Understanding the scope and limits of your policy coverage is key to maximizing your recovery.

Fighting the Insurance Company After a Car Accident

avvo-badge

After a car accident, filing a claim with the insurance company might feel like a routine step, but getting a fair settlement is rarely that simple. Whether you’re seeking compensation from the at-fault driver’s insurer or dealing with your own carrier under a personal injury protection (PIP) or uninsured motorist policy, you need to be prepared for resistance. Insurance companies are not in the business of paying out more than they have to, and they employ various tactics to reduce or deny valid claims.

From the outset, adjusters may appear helpful, asking for statements or medical records under the guise of moving your claim forward. In reality, they are often looking for reasons to dispute the severity of your injuries or shift blame for the accident. Something as simple as an offhand comment during a recorded call can later be used to minimize your injuries or suggest you were partially at fault. These strategies are not accidental but are designed to protect the insurer’s bottom line.

In more aggressive cases, insurers may engage in bad faith practices, such as:

  • Delaying responses or payment without justification
  • Misrepresenting the terms of your policy
  • Offering an unreasonably low settlement with pressure to accept quickly
  • Failing to do a thorough investigation into your claim
  • Denying coverage without providing a valid explanation

Spring Hill Car Accident FAQs

What is the first thing I should do after a car accident in Spring Hill?

First, ensure everyone is safe and call 911 to report the accident and request medical assistance for any injuries. If you are able, use your phone to take pictures of the accident scene, all vehicles involved, and any visible injuries.

Exchange contact and insurance information with the other driver, but do not discuss fault or apologize. Seek a medical evaluation as soon as possible, even if you feel fine, as some serious injuries have delayed symptoms.

How long do I have to file a car accident lawsuit in Florida?

For most personal injury claims based on negligence, including car accidents, Florida law requires you to file a lawsuit within two years of the date of the accident.

If you miss this deadline, known as the statute of limitations, the court will likely dismiss your case permanently. It is critical to contact an attorney well before this deadline to preserve your rights.

What if the other driver's insurance company calls me and offers a settlement?

You should not accept a settlement offer or provide a recorded statement to the other driver’s insurance company without first consulting an attorney. Initial offers are often far lower than the actual value of your claim and do not account for future medical needs, lost income, or your pain and suffering.

Signing a settlement agreement is final and prevents you from seeking any further compensation for your injuries.
